over the weekend I tested the UnifiedPush server, deployed on my private
OpenShift account. I sent 30k+ messages from my Mac to UP on OpenShift.
Messages were received on my iPad and my Galaxy SII.

* 10k Messages from JUnit (via Java Client). Message Rate: every 5 seconds.

* 10k Messages from JUnit (via Java Client). Message Rate: every
2.5 seconds

* 10k Messages from JUnit (via Java Client). Message Rate: every
1.5 seconds

Besides that a cron job was submitting messages to OpenShift (using cURL)
every minute.

The system worked fine on OpenShift, and the iOS/Android apps were able to
receive the messages just fine.

When I submitted 550 async jobs (using cURL) the apps had issues to display
all of the messages, as they came in very quick. However this is a stupid
test scenario anyways, as push is not for chats :-)

The OpenShift based deployment of UnifiedPush worked fine for all of these
tests.
